How to navigate through the content funnel

Content is the way a regular customer goes from seeing your site for the first time to clicking on your affiliate link and making a purchase. Also, as it becomes more and more difficult to attract the customers you choose today, the content panel allows you to influence a potential customer cunningly and seamlessly, tailoring their needs.

 

The content panel consists of four main categories:

 

Awareness / Awareness

Interest

Desire

Action

When developing a content strategy, keep in mind that creating content for each category of content takes a different approach. What works in the first category may not be attractive to third-class customers.

 

Awareness / Awareness is the phase of acquiring basic information. At this point, the user acknowledges the problem and learns about your product. The task here is to provide enough content to help the audience to know and find out more about the problem.

In the Interest section, you first pass on to the user the amount of product promoted and build trust. Provide additional useful content that reflects the promoted product from different perspectives, helping readers to focus more on the problem and make them stay longer on your site.

Desire stage is a point where you show your benefits of the offer. Tell us why this product is better than others, will give it to the user directly, and show you the options for using it.

The Action Section suggests providing content that will entice readers to click your link and book an advertiser service.

By understanding all these steps, you can create a content marketing strategy that will gradually move the user to the right content and bring in clicks.

 

Terms of content marketing

Depending on the channel stage, content marketing objectives involve different types of content. Here are five examples:

 

1. Teach

The main function here is to share information about this issue and introduce users to the promoted product. Therefore, the objectives of the content marketing strategy in this section are to attract customers and product awareness. For example, if you are promoting hotels and resorts, it could be an article about choosing the right tourist destination and the like. Try to bring value and avoid advertising.

 

Contents of this category:

 

Education blog posts

Infographics

Webinars

E-books

A series of blog posts

Audio and video podcasts

To test the effectiveness of content creation strategy, rely on the following indicators:

 

Page views and traffic

Increase the number of indicators. Measured by monitoring systems, growing hashtags with name and user-generated content

The power of engagement, likes, and comments

2. Get involved

Once a user is familiar with a product, try to arouse their interest and encourage them to work on your site. One of the most popular objectives of content marketing in this category is direct customer engagement. It is not the time for direct advertising, but rather for making users stay longer on your site and continue to learn about your offer.

 

Good engagement category content:

 

Cases showcasing technology and creating a wow effect

Educational resources: a series of letters “from A to Z”, educational topics, webinars

Resources: Checklists, instructions, details, e-books, mind maps

Tests and surveys related to your offer

User stories, reviews, comparisons

To test the effectiveness of your strategy for creating content in this section, consider:

 

Sharing on social media, especially for targeted audiences

Comments

CTR indicators

Be prepared for spam and negative comments. Look for negative comments and ignore spam.

 

3. Improve SEO

An effective SEO strategy requires active content creation and review. And any content requires proper preparation. You can write a good article, but without proper SEO on the page, it will be difficult to achieve the results you want.

 

So be sure to:

 

Use short and long keywords both in the title and in the body of the text

Adjust photos

Use external and internal links

Add CTAs

Find the same words and LSI keywords

To check how well you fit the marketing objectives of this section, consider:

 

Your access (number of views, posts, and updates)

Product awareness (increased demand for product inquiries, increase in direct traffic)

Backlink profile growth. Track the quality of the sites and the number of posts and the response of the target audience, changes in the company mentioned after publication (tone — positive, neutral, negative).

4. Generate leads

The main goal of this section is to collect contact details of potential buyers. To accomplish this, provide important content.

 

Consider using the following content types:

 

Webinars

E-books, PDFs, and other downloads

Checklists

Newspaper

Surveys and questions

Competitions and prizes

To test the effectiveness of website content strategies at this point, check out the clicks (via CTA) and conversions.

 

5. Bring sales

The goal of this section is to encourage users to click on your managed links and make reservations. Other examples of content marketing objectives are customer retention and activation, increasing the average check, purchasing frequency, and customer life cycle.

 

On average, you have to deliver the product 7 times before the customer is ready to buy! Therefore, give a potential customer a clear opportunity to click on your related link and do it again and again.

 

Use the following content types:

 

Cases and updates. Direct customer feedback may encourage other users to follow their path

Webinars

Comparison topics

Emails have personal offers

The most effective estimates of the content strategy in this category are booking price, average customer value, purchase frequency, and average order price.
